2. Creative Themes for Whimsical Easter Baskets
When creating a whimsical Easter basket display, one of the most fun ways to go is to choose a theme. Themes give you the creative freedom to play with colors, items, and layouts. Here are some ideas for whimsical Easter basket themes:
Fairy Garden Theme
- Magical and Enchanting: Transform your Easter basket into a whimsical fairy garden by adding small artificial flowers, miniature fairy figurines, and tiny wooden fences. Use moss as a base and fill the basket with pastel-colored candies and chocolates.
- Fairy Lights: String some battery-operated fairy lights around the basket to give it a magical glow. This makes the display enchanting for both daytime and evening settings.
Bunny Wonderland Theme
- Playful and Cute: Embrace the classic Easter bunny with a bunny-themed basket. Fill the basket with plush bunny toys, bunny-shaped cookies, and Easter egg chocolates.
- Bunny Tails and Ears: Add a cute touch by incorporating fluffy pom-pom “tails” or bunny ears to the basket handle or inside the basket. You can even use cotton candy as a whimsical substitute for bunny tails!
Spring Blooms Theme
- Floral Fantasy: Celebrate the season’s flowers by filling your Easter basket with fresh or artificial spring blooms, such as tulips, daffodils, and daisies. Add colorful ribbons or tulle in pastel shades to enhance the springtime feel.
- Flower Pot Baskets: Instead of traditional woven baskets, try using small flower pots or decorative ceramic containers as the base for your Easter baskets. This adds a rustic, garden-inspired twist.
Easter Picnic Basket
- Outdoor Fun: Give your Easter basket a picnic twist by adding mini bottles of lemonade, small jars of jam, or tiny sandwiches. Include a soft, pastel-colored cloth napkin and even a small wooden tray to complete the “picnic” look.
- Faux Grass and Easter Eggs: Line the basket with faux grass and scatter plastic or wooden Easter eggs filled with treats for an extra playful touch.
Toyland Theme
- Childlike Delight: If you’re creating baskets for kids, fill them with fun toys, such as plush animals, puzzles, or even small LEGO sets. Use a toy-themed basket, such as a toy dump truck, wagon, or colorful bucket, to enhance the playful feel.
- Candy and Craft Kits: Mix candy with craft kits—think markers, stickers, and DIY bunny masks to keep children entertained after they enjoy their basket.
3. How to Style Your Whimsical Easter Basket Display
Once you have a theme, the next step is to style your whimsical Easter basket display. Here are some creative ways to make your baskets stand out:
Layering with Filler Materials
- Paper Grass or Shredded Paper: Instead of traditional plastic grass, use shredded paper or natural paper grass as a filler. You can find biodegradable options, which add an eco-friendly touch. Opt for soft pastel or bright neon-colored shredded paper for a more modern, playful aesthetic.
- Tissue Paper or Fabric: Use fabric squares or colorful tissue paper to layer beneath the contents of your basket. This can add texture and help to hold everything in place.
Use Transparent Containers for a Fresh Look
- Glass Jars or Mason Jars: For a modern twist, consider using clear glass jars or mason jars as baskets. Fill them with small chocolates, jelly beans, or Easter treats, and tie a ribbon around the jar’s top for a finished look.
- Clear Boxes: Use clear acrylic boxes to showcase candies, decorative items, or small gifts. The transparency of these containers gives a clean and elegant touch while still highlighting the contents.
Add Decorative Elements
- Ribbon and Bows: No Easter basket is complete without a fun ribbon. Use wide, satin ribbons in bright colors or soft pastels to tie around the handle or top of the basket. You can also create bows and use them to add whimsy and dimension to the display.
- Easter Eggs: Decorate your baskets with colorful Easter eggs. These can be traditional painted wooden eggs, plastic eggs filled with surprises, or even hand-painted DIY eggs. Nest the eggs among the filler material for an extra pop of color.
- Floral Accents: Fresh or faux flowers can add a soft, spring-like vibe to your baskets. Tuck small bouquets of flowers like daisies, lilies, or tulips around the edges or handle of the basket.
4. Creative Ways to Present Whimsical Easter Baskets
How you present your whimsical Easter baskets can be just as important as the contents. Here are some fun and creative ways to display Easter baskets:
Hanging Easter Baskets
- Suspended Charm: Hang small Easter baskets from the ceiling using colorful ribbons or twine. You can create a magical “Easter basket chandelier” effect by hanging multiple baskets at varying heights. Add fairy lights to each basket for an enchanting glow.
Easter Basket Centerpiece
- Table Setting: Use an Easter basket as the centerpiece for your dining table or buffet. Surround it with candles, flowers, or pastel-colored plates to complement the whimsical feel. This serves as both an eye-catching display and a functional way to present Easter treats.
- Tiered Display: For a more elaborate look, place your Easter baskets on a tiered display stand. This adds height and dimension to your arrangement, creating visual interest.
Use a Wooden Crate or Box
- Rustic Display: For a charming rustic look, place multiple baskets in a wooden crate or box. Add burlap fabric as a liner and nestle the baskets within it. This works particularly well for a more farmhouse-style or vintage Easter celebration.
- Box with Lids: Use a vintage suitcase or decorative box with a lid. Open it up to reveal the baskets inside, creating a whimsical surprise for guests or children.
5. Personalizing Your Whimsical Easter Baskets
Personalization adds a unique and thoughtful touch to your whimsical Easter baskets. Here’s how you can make each basket feel special:
Add Custom Tags or Labels
- Name Tags: Add personalized name tags or small labels to each basket. You can use cute paper tags or craft personalized wooden tags for a more rustic look.
- Message or Poem: Include a small note or Easter poem tucked inside each basket for a sweet and personal touch.
Include Personalized Gifts
- Custom Treats: Consider adding personalized items, such as custom chocolate bars, monogrammed towels, or personalized Easter-themed mugs. These thoughtful gifts can be tucked into the basket for an extra special touch.
- Mini Gift Sets: For adults, you can create mini gift sets inside the baskets with skincare products, candles, or gourmet treats. Choose items that match the theme and color of the basket for added cohesion.
